  • Patent number: 11565424
    Abstract: A computer-implemented method includes detecting, at a processor and by a plurality of associates, a mission to be performed by the plurality of associates; identifying the mission based on associated store information comprising an inventory status, sales data, and a set of predetermined rules; generating, by the processor, a queue of tasks to complete the mission based on priorities and dependencies of the tasks; determining a task for each associate whose profile defines best abilities matching a predetermined task dataset and the associated store information; assigning the queue of tasks to the plurality of the associates to complete the tasks; receiving, from each of the associates, a notification of a completion of an assigned task; verifying, by the processor, the completion of the assigned task; and determining, by the processor, completion of the mission when each task for the mission is verified to be completed.
    Type: Grant
    Filed: February 17, 2021
    Date of Patent: January 31, 2023
    Assignee: Walmart Apollo, LLC
    Inventors: Donald R. High, Robert Cantrell, Mike Atchley, Wallace Carrell King, Brian Harrison, Amy J. Savaiinaea

  • Publication number: 20160034121
    Abstract: A control circuit identifies users within a presentation zone that includes a plurality of displays. The control circuit then automatically selects at least two particular presentations from amongst a plurality of available presentations. By one approach one of the selected presentations corresponds to one of the identified users while another of the selected presentations corresponds to another of the identified users. The control circuit then automatically presents, at least substantially simultaneously, the selected presentations using the plurality of displays in the presentation zone.

  • Publication number: 20160034520
    Abstract: A control circuit maintains and stores in a memory a log for a retail enterprise of information comprising the current status of various items including data preparation, aggregation of values, execution of statistical models, and development visualizations for each of a plurality of items that are offered for retail sale within the retail enterprise. By one approach the plurality of items represents only a subset of all items that are offered for retail sale by this retail enterprise. By another approach the plurality of items represents all items that are offered for retail sale by this retail enterprise. If desired, the aforementioned log comprises such information for each of a plurality of hierarchical user levels in the retail enterprise.

  • Publication number: 20160034164
    Abstract: A control circuit presents, via one or more displays, one or more analytical results as correspond to currently-selected values for two or more variables. That control circuit additionally forms and presents, via at least one such display, a virtual tool for each of the at least two variables, such that a user can selectively vary the variables by movement of the corresponding virtual tool. By one approach the virtual tool presents a visual indication of a present relative value of the corresponding variable (as versus an absolute or specific value for the variable). In such a case, and by one approach, the plurality of virtual tools can each present a visual indication of a present relative value of their corresponding variable using a same relative scale. If desired, the foregoing relative scale can include both positive and negative values.
